All claims arising out of this Agreement or its breach shall be submitted to mediation by a <br /> mediator agreed to by both parties prior to the filing of litigation. <br /> appliGable statutes. <br /> 15) Hazardous Substances and Conditions. Kimley-Horn shall not be a custodian,transporter, handler, arranger, <br /> contractor, or remediator with respect to hazardous substances and conditions. Kimley-Horn's services will be <br /> limited to analysis, recommendations, and reporting, including, when agreed to, plans and specifications for <br /> isolation, removal, or remediation. Kimley-Horn will notify the Client of unanticipated hazardous substances or <br /> conditions of which Kimley-Horn actually becomes aware. Kimley-Horn may stop affected portions of its services <br /> until the hazardous substance or condition is eliminated. <br /> 16) Construction Phase Services. <br /> a. If Kimley-Horn prepares construction documents and Kimley-Horn is not retained to make periodic site visits, the <br /> Client assumes all responsibility for interpretation of the documents and for construction observation,and the Client <br /> waives any claims against Kimley-Horn in any way connected thereto. <br /> b. Kimley-Horn shall have no responsibility for any contractor's means, methods, techniques, equipment choice and <br /> usage, equipment maintenance and inspection, sequence, schedule, safety programs, or safety practices, nor <br /> shall Kimley-Horn have any authority or responsibility to stop or direct the work of any contractor. Kimley-Horn's <br /> visits will be for the purpose of endeavoring to provide the Client a greater degree of confidence that the completed <br /> work of its contractors will generally conform to the construction documents prepared by Kimley-Horn. Kimley- <br /> Horn neither guarantees the performance of contractors, nor assumes responsibility for any contractor's failure to <br /> perform its work in accordance with the contract documents. <br /> c. Kimley-Horn is not responsible for any duties assigned to it in the construction contract that are not expressly <br /> provided for in this Agreement. The Client agrees that each contract with any contractor shall state that the <br /> contractor shall be solely responsible for job site safety and its means and methods; that the contractor shall <br /> indemnify the Client and Kimley-Horn for all claims and liability arising out of job site accidents; and that the Client <br /> and Kimley-Horn shall be made additional insureds under the contractor's general liability insurance policy. <br /> 17) No Third-Party Beneficiaries;Assignment and Subcontracting. This Agreement gives no rights or benefits to <br /> anyone other than the Client and Kimley-Horn, and all duties and responsibilities undertaken pursuant to this <br /> Agreement will be for the sole benefit of the Client and Kimley-Horn. The Client shall not assign or transfer any <br /> rights under or interest in this Agreement, or any claim arising out of the performance of services by Kimley-Horn, <br /> without the written consent of Kimley-Horn. Kimley-Horn reserves the right to augment its staff with subconsultants <br /> as it deems appropriate due to project logistics, schedules, or market conditions. If Kimley-Horn exercises this <br /> right, Kimley-Horn will maintain the agreed-upon billing rates for services identified in the contract, regardless of <br /> whether the services are provided by in-house employees, contract employees, or independent subconsultants. <br /> 18) Confidentiality. The Client consents to the use and dissemination by Kimley-Horn of photographs of the project <br /> and to the use by Kimley-Horn of facts, data and information obtained by Kimley-Horn in the performance of its <br /> services. If,however,any facts,data or information are specifically identified in writing by the Client as confidential, <br /> Kimley-Horn shall use reasonable care to maintain the confidentiality of that material. <br /> 19) Miscellaneous Provisions. This Agreement is to be governed by the law of the State where the Project is located. <br /> This Agreement contains the entire and fully integrated agreement between the parties and supersedes all prior <br /> and contemporaneous negotiations, representations, agreements, or understandings, whether written or oral. <br /> Except as provided in Section 1, this Agreement can be supplemented or amended only by a written document <br /> executed by both parties. Any conflicting or additional terms on any purchase order issued by the Client shall be <br /> void and are hereby expressly rejected by Kimley-Horn. If Client requires Kimley-Horn to register with or use an <br /> online vendor portal for payment or any other purpose, any terms included in the registration or use of the online <br /> vendor portal that are inconsistent or in addition to these terms shall be void and shall have no effect on Kimley- <br /> Horn or this Agreement. Any provision in this Agreement that is unenforceable shall be ineffective to the extent of <br /> such unenforceability without invalidating the remaining provisions.The non-enforcement of any provision by either <br /> party shall not constitute a waiver of that provision nor shall it affect the enforceability of that provision or of the <br /> remainder of this Agreement. <br /> Rev 06/2023 DED <br /> 3 <br />
